Abstract The blue compact starbursting galaxy ESO 338-IG04 has been found to be very rich in globular clusters (GCs) of varying age, from a few Myr to 10 Gyr. Among low mass galaxies, it appears to be an extraordinary efficient GC factory, and its GC richness is fully comparable to those of giant ellipticals. An important GC formation event occured some 2.5 Gyrs ago. In this age category we find cluster no. \#34, an unusually massive cluster with \cal M 10^7 \cal M_\odot. Here, we propose to observe this cluster, and two other intermediate age massive GC candidates. The aim is to derive ages, metallicities and internal extinction, in a self consistent way. This will provide a test on the origin and chemical evolution of the host galaxy, and a possibilty to assess the reliability of photometrically derived ages and masses for young GC candidates in general. The latter point is important, because GCs, beeing fossil starbursts, may be used to probe the starburst history of galaxies in the universe. We aim at a formal signal to noise (S/N) of 20 per resoultion element at 4000 Angstrom \ and 7000 Angstrom (before background subtraction). With the use of the 52X0.1 slit total exposure times of 7600s would be required for the blue part (G430L) and 4000s for the red part. In addition a second (and likely a third) luminous cluster will be observed through the same slit. For example, a slit angle of 12 degrees (from N to E) would allow also clusters no. \#43 and \#44 in the inner sample to be observed at the ame time. These have estimated ages of 400 and 60 Myr respectively, and masses ~ 2 * 10^6 \cal M_\odot. The final choise may be subject to the orientation constraints which are not known at this moment but there are several interesting candidates with m_f555w~ 21 for which S/N = 10 can be achieved. The exposures will be split in 900s- 1200s long subexposures. The STIS is also a very sensitive instrument for imaging. With a short 300 seconds (CR-split) image in clear imaging mode we can reach 2 magnitudes deeper than previous WFPC2 observations and reach below m_V = 26 with a S/N of 5. In total, including overheads, the proposed observations would require 5 orbits.
